The partial exemption applies only to the state general and fiscal recovery funds portion of the sales and use tax, currently 5.00 percent. However, if you purchase your vessel through a broker, the broker may, but is not required to, collect and report the tax to the CDTFA. A statement signed by the seller verifying the vehicle was delivered to you outside of California. If the broker collects and reports the correct amount of tax to CDTFA, you have no additional liability. When a boat is registered in S.C., the registration number for that boat stays the same for as long as it remains registered in S.C.
